The Burngreave Messenger is a community newspaper with editorial independence, funded by advertising and The National Lottery Community Fund. It is delivered free to over 9000 households in the Burngreave Ward of Sheffield, including Ellesmere, Carwood, Firshill, Fir Vale, Grimesthorpe, Osgathorpe, Pitsmoor, Pye Bank and parts of Shirecliffe.
